import type { V2NavItem } from '@/types/v2/nav'
/**
* Pure helper — determines whether a V2NavItem is "active" given the current
* route name.
*
* Active rules (simplest correct definition):
* 1. Exact match: currentRouteName === item.to.name
* 2. Prefix match for nested routes: currentRouteName starts with
* item.to.name + '-' (e.g. item "organisation" is active on
* "organisation-settings"). The dash boundary prevents "org" from
* spuriously matching "organisation-settings".
*
* Only `to` values that are a plain object with a string `name` property are
* compared — string/array `to` values always return false (router-push
* style not used in v1 nav).
*/
export function isNavItemActive(
item: V2NavItem,
currentRouteName: string | symbol | null | undefined,
): boolean {
if (typeof currentRouteName !== 'string')
return false
const to = item.to
if (typeof to !== 'object' || to === null || Array.isArray(to))
return false
const itemName = (to as { name?: unknown }).name
if (typeof itemName !== 'string')
return false
return currentRouteName === itemName
|| currentRouteName.startsWith(`${itemName}-`)
}

import { computed } from 'vue'
import type { ComputedRef } from 'vue'
import type { V2NavGroup, V2NavItem } from '@/types/v2/nav'
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
// Local discriminated union for v1 nav entries (no `any`)
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
interface V1NavHeading {
heading: string
}
interface V1NavLink {
title: string
to: { name: string }
icon: { icon: string }
count?: number
}
export type V1NavEntry = V1NavHeading | V1NavLink
function isHeading(entry: V1NavEntry): entry is V1NavHeading {
return 'heading' in entry
}
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
// Pure adapter — exported so it can be unit-tested without mounting
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
/**
* Folds a flat v1 nav array into V2NavGroup[].
*
* - A `{ heading }` entry closes the current group and opens a new one.
* - Items before the first heading are placed in a leading group with label ''.
* - A pure function with no side-effects.
*/
export function toV2NavGroups(items: readonly V1NavEntry[]): V2NavGroup[] {
if (items.length === 0)
return []
const groups: V2NavGroup[] = []
let current: V2NavGroup | null = null
for (const entry of items) {
if (isHeading(entry)) {
// Close current group (if any) and start a new named group.
if (current !== null)
groups.push(current)
current = { label: entry.heading, items: [] }
}
else {
// Ensure there is a current group (leading ungrouped section).
if (current === null)
current = { label: '', items: [] }
const navItem: V2NavItem = {
id: entry.to.name,
label: entry.title,
icon: entry.icon.icon,
to: { name: entry.to.name },
...(entry.count !== undefined ? { count: entry.count } : {}),
}
current.items.push(navItem)
}
}
// Flush the last open group.
if (current !== null)
groups.push(current)
return groups
}
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
// Composable
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
/**
* Wraps toV2NavGroups in a computed ref.
*
* Accepts the raw v1 nav items as a parameter so the composable (composables
* boundary zone) does not need to import from @/navigation (navigation zone).
* Call-sites in layouts/pages — which ARE allowed to import navigation —
* pass orgNavItems directly:
*
* import { orgNavItems } from '@/navigation/vertical'
* const { groups } = useV2Nav(orgNavItems)
*/
export function useV2Nav(items: readonly V1NavEntry[]): { groups: ComputedRef<V2NavGroup[]> } {
const groups = computed(() => toV2NavGroups(items))
return { groups }
}
